Subject: Handover — validator plugin stuff

Hey Priya,

Passing you the baton on Checkwright, our plugin system for data validators. The new schema-drift plugin shipped Tuesday and mostly behaves, but it occasionally flags empty CSV uploads as "malformed" — harmless, just noisy. I've muted the alert until Friday. If support escalates anything about plugin load failures, the fix is usually bumping the registry cache. Questions after I'm off? Reach the Checkwright maintainers at the address below.

billing contact of hawip-kahif = zorwyn@tolvaqlabs.corp

# Break-Glass: Config Hot-Reload (Team Larkspur)

Hey newcomers — our Driftwell service hot-reloads config from the Pinecone store every 30 seconds. If a bad push bricks the loop, break-glass lets you pin a known-good snapshot directly. Use it sparingly and ping the channel after. The pinning tool needs the ops vault unsealed first, and the recovery passphrase for that is below.

recovery phrase for fajep-yaweg: gilath-sorox-wenius-rusdor-keliel-zorius

So, future maintainer: the infamous refresh stampede of last spring happened because clients retried token refreshes with no backoff, and our quota layer happily let them. We now cap refresh attempts per session window and enforce a minimum interval between refreshes. If you loosen these, the auth tier will remind you why they exist. Grace periods are deliberately short — expired-but-refreshing tokens are accepted only briefly. Don't touch the window math without rerunning the stampede simulation. Current limits are defined below.

tuning constants:
QUOTAS = {
    "druwyn": 5,
    "holix": 5,
    "zorath": 5,
    "holwyn": 10,
}